CI note (Thumbkin resize CLI): if the batch-resize suite fails on the Garnet runners with an out-of-memory kill, the fixture images were not pruned by the previous job. Clear the scratch volume, re-queue, and confirm the smoke set passes before investigating further. When filing a ticket, include the failing pipeline's trace token, shown directly below this note.

build token for fajof-yahof: htk4_869f

Subject: Cut-over complete — reset flow revamp

Team,

The Fernwick password reset revamp went live last night. Old token-in-URL flow is disabled; all resets now use short-lived one-time codes with server-side session binding. Legacy endpoints return 410. No rollbacks needed during the window; error rates stayed flat. Audit logging now covers issue, redeem, and expiry events. Please verify the hardening settings against the approved baseline. The live configuration is below.

settings of tageg-fajof:
zorath:
  pin: 6916
  metrics_host: metrics.zorath.lumiclabs.internal
  tenant: julox
  seal: seal_51bea044

## FlagForge Onboarding — Recovery Access

Welcome to the FlagForge rollout framework team. Flag definitions live in the config store, and rollout stages are managed through the Conductor UI. Contractors get read access by default; write access comes after your first reviewed change. If the Conductor admin account is ever locked during an incident, the on-call restores it from the sealed backup, which is unlocked with the passphrase shown below.

unlock words, hafop-tahog: drumir-druiel-kasox-wenax-tamys-frair

## Deploying Brushcutter

Welcome aboard! Brushcutter is our stale-branch cleanup bot — it scans the Foxhollow repos nightly and files deletion proposals for branches untouched past the cutoff. Deploys go through the Larchgate pipeline; just merge to main and the pipeline handles the rest, usually within ten minutes. One gotcha: dry-run mode must stay on for your first week. The deployment reads its configuration from the values below.

config for kafof-bawef:
holath:
  log_level: debug
  metrics_host: metrics.holath.qorvelsys.internal
  pin: 2191
  pool_size: 32